Output 681da56548d497fb1605661b0683afb2584121f4fe76fefcb2140b98192c40e4:0

value
66292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 158d42b22fd7e32d9cbf26bb953c6b07434cd602 OP_EQUAL
address
33eyLXTfGtg1mEZyPwKM39MK3pZpjtYn3p
transaction
681da56548d497fb1605661b0683afb2584121f4fe76fefcb2140b98192c40e4
spent
true